Team management is the art and science of effectively leading and coordinating a group of individuals toward achieving common goals. It involves overseeing the efforts of team members, guiding them, and ensuring their collaboration to maximize productivity and results. A group is a collection of individuals who coordinate their efforts, while a team is a group of people who share a common goal. While similar, the two are different when it comes to decision-making and teamwork. In a work group, group members are independent from one another and have individual accountability.Jan 30, 2023 · 1. Autocratic management style. Autocratic managers centralize the decision-making process. On these teams, the manager usually makes the majority of decisions—including what the team should focus on, what short- and long-term goals they should work toward, and which tasks and projects are associated with these initiatives.
